Join our roads team at recruitment sessions
Published: Thursday 4 June 2026
Exciting opportunities to join South Lanarkshire Council’s roads teams take place this month.
Drop-in recruitment sessions for roadworkers and chargehands will be held at depots across the area on four separate nights.
Staff from the council’s Roads and Transportation Service will be available for anyone to find out more about opportunities to join the team.
Each event takes place from 6pm to 9pm, with the first at Canderside Depot, 1 Carlisle Road, Larkhall, ML9 2GA on Tuesday 16 June.
The second event, on Wednesday 17 June, is at Hawbank Depot, 18 Hawbank Road, East Kilbride, G74 5HA.
The following week on Wednesday 24 June it’s the turn of Lesmahagow Depot, B7078 Carlisle Road, Lesmahagow, ML11 0DZ.
The final event is on Thursday 25 June at Carnwath Depot, Braehead Road, Carnwath, ML11 8LR.
Head of Roads, Transportation and Fleet Services, Colin Park, said: “I would encourage anyone looking to either start or further their career in roads maintenance to come along to one of our open evenings.
“Each event is a drop-in session – no appointment is needed.
“You will have the opportunity to meet the team, learn about the roles, get information on applying, ask questions and explore career opportunities.”
